别瞎配置!CI/IC 服务器 + 住宅 IP 避坑指南
在当今互联网环境中,CI/IC (Continuous Integration/Continuous Deployment) 服务器与住宅 IP 的配置已成为许多开发者和企业的必备工具。然而,不当的配置可能导致性能下降、安全隐患甚至服务中断。本文将深入探讨如何正确配置 CI/IC 服务器并规避住宅 IP 使用中的常见陷阱。
CI/IC 服务器的核心配置原则
环境隔离:始终为不同项目或环境(开发、测试、生产)配置独立的运行环境。混用环境可能导致依赖冲突和不可预测的行为。
资源限额:为每个构建任务设置合理的 CPU、内存和磁盘 I/O 限制,防止单个任务耗尽系统资源影响其他服务。
安全凭证管理:永远不要将敏感信息硬编码在配置文件中。使用 Ciuic 服务器 提供的密钥管理服务或第三方密钥管理工具。
住宅 IP 使用中的常见误区
许多用户误以为住宅 IP 能解决所有反爬虫和地域限制问题,实则不然:
IP 信誉问题:过度使用同一住宅 IP 进行高频请求会导致 IP 被标记为异常,最终被目标网站封禁。
地理位置不匹配:某些住宅 IP 虽然显示为特定地区,但实际出口节点可能在完全不同的位置,导致地理定位服务失效。
带宽限制:住宅 IP 通常有严格的带宽限制,不适合高流量应用。
专业解决方案推荐
对于需要稳定、高效 CI/IC 服务的企业,推荐使用专业的云服务如 Ciuic 云服务器。其优势包括:
全球分布式节点,确保低延迟专为 CI/CD 优化的硬件配置内置 Docker 和 Kubernetes 支持灵活的自动扩展能力住宅 IP 的替代方案
当确实需要 IP 多样化时,考虑以下替代方案:
专业代理服务:相比住宅 IP,数据中心代理通常提供更高的稳定性和带宽。
IP 轮换策略:通过智能轮换算法平衡请求分布,避免单一 IP 过载。
请求速率控制:实现自适应请求间隔,模拟人类操作模式。
最佳实践案例
某电商企业曾因不当配置导致 CI 服务器每天意外触发数百次构建,消耗大量资源。通过以下改进解决了问题:
在 Ciuic 平台 上重建 CI 环境实现基于分支的触发条件设置构建队列优先级系统引入自动缩放机制改造后,构建时间缩短 40%,月度成本降低 35%。
总结
正确的 CI/IC 服务器配置和 IP 策略不仅能提升工作效率,还能显著降低成本。避免"能用就行"的配置思维,投资于专业解决方案如 Ciuic 云服务 将带来长期回报。记住,在技术领域,预防问题的成本远低于解决问题的成本。
